– We’ve noted how WWE doctors won’t clear Daniel Bryan to return to the ring due to concerns they have but Bryan says he’s ready and has had one outside doctor clear him. A source notes that Bryan continues to push WWE officials hard in regards to getting cleared. Bryan realizes he can’t be off TV too much longer if they still want to capitalize on his momentum. He also realizes there’s a need for another top babyface right now.

– WWE recently signed “Psycho” Sid Eudy to a Legends deal for licensing and merchandising. Expect to see new Sid action figures before the end of the year.
